Overview of Central Vacuum Systems
A central vacuum system is a permanent, built-in cleaning solution that offers superior power and convenience compared to traditional portable vacuums. It consists of a power unit (motor and dirt collection canister) typically installed in a garage, basement, or utility room, connected to a network of tubing run within the walls of your home. Strategically placed wall inlets throughout the house allow a lightweight hose to be plugged in, providing powerful suction wherever needed. This design eliminates the need to carry a heavy vacuum, search for outlets, or deal with recirculated dust, significantly improving your cleaning experience.
The concept of a central vacuum isn’t new; early versions emerged in the late 19th and early 20th centuries. Over time, advancements in motor technology, filtration, and system design have transformed them into the sophisticated, efficient appliances we see today. Modern central vacuum systems are engineered for quiet operation, exceptional suction, and advanced allergen filtration, making them a cornerstone of healthy home environments. Their permanent installation during the new home build phase allows for optimal pipe routing and inlet placement, maximizing efficiency and minimizing future disruption.

Popular Central Vacuum System Types by Filtration
When choosing a central vacuum system, the filtration and dust collection method is a primary consideration, impacting air quality and maintenance. Modern systems primarily fall into three categories: bagged, bagless, and hybrid.
Bagged Central Vacuum Systems
Bagged central vacuum systems utilize disposable bags within the collection canister to capture dirt and debris. When the bag is full, it is simply removed and discarded, making the emptying process exceptionally clean and dust-free.
- Pros:
- Superior Air Quality: Bags trap microscopic dust, allergens, and pet dander more effectively, preventing them from re-entering the air.
- Clean Disposal: No direct contact with dirt during emptying, ideal for allergy sufferers.
- Less Frequent Maintenance: Filters often last longer as the bag protects the motor.
- Cons:
- Ongoing Cost: Replacement bags are a recurring expense.
- Reduced Capacity: Bags can take up space, potentially reducing the overall collection volume compared to bagless systems of similar size.
- How to choose: For maximum allergen retention and minimal mess, bagged systems are an excellent choice. Look for models with high-efficiency bags and adequate capacity for your home size.

Bagless Central Vacuum Systems
Bagless central vacuum systems collect dirt and debris directly into a large canister, often utilizing cyclonic separation to filter particles. The canister is emptied directly into a trash can when full.
- Pros:
- No Recurring Costs: Eliminates the need to buy replacement bags.
- Eco-Friendly: Reduces waste by not using disposable bags.
- Large Capacity: Canisters often have a larger usable volume than bagged systems.
- Cons:
- Dust Exposure: Emptying the canister can release a small cloud of dust, which might be an issue for allergy sufferers.
- More Frequent Filter Cleaning: Filters may need more regular cleaning to maintain optimal performance.
- How to choose: If you prioritize convenience and avoiding recurring costs, a bagless system is suitable. Look for units with clear-view windows to monitor dirt levels and easy-to-clean washable filters.
Hybrid Central Vacuum Systems
Hybrid central vacuum systems offer the best of both worlds, providing the flexibility to operate with or without a disposable bag. This adaptability allows homeowners to switch between modes based on their cleaning needs or preferences.
- Pros:
- Flexibility: Use bags for enhanced filtration and clean disposal, or go bagless for cost savings and larger capacity.
- Adaptability: Ideal for households where needs may change, such as when allergy seasons are particularly bad or during heavy cleaning projects.
- Cons:
- Potential Compromises: While versatile, some hybrid systems may not offer the absolute peak performance in either bagged or bagless mode compared to dedicated systems.
- How to choose: Hybrid systems are excellent for those who want options. Consider models with easy-to-switch mechanisms and robust filtration whether a bag is in use or not.

Important Criteria When Choosing a Central Vacuum System
Selecting the right central vacuum system for your new home involves evaluating several key performance indicators and features. Understanding these criteria will help you match a system to your specific needs and ensure long-term satisfaction.
Suction Power (Airwatts vs. CFM)
The effectiveness of a central vacuum largely depends on its suction power, typically measured in Airwatts (AW) and Cubic Feet per Minute (CFM).
- Airwatts quantify the actual cleaning power at the end of the hose, reflecting both airflow and water lift. A higher airwatt rating indicates stronger suction, crucial for deep cleaning carpets, picking up pet hair, and covering large areas. For homes, 500-600 Airwatts are generally adequate for light cleaning, 600-700 AW for typical household cleaning, and 700+ AW for excellent deep cleaning and pet hair removal.
- CFM measures the volume of air moved per minute, indicating the system’s ability to pick up larger debris. While both are important, Airwatts often correlate better with real-world cleaning performance.
- Choosing Wisely: When selecting a system for a new home, it’s recommended to choose a unit with an airwatt rating that provides a buffer—ideally, rated for 20-25% more square footage than your actual home size. This ensures consistent suction even at the furthest inlets and accounts for varying hose lengths and attachment types.
Noise Level
One of the most appealing advantages of a central vacuum system is its quiet operation within the living space. The main power unit, which houses the motor, is typically installed in a remote location such as a garage, basement, or utility room. This strategic placement significantly dampens noise, allowing for a much quieter cleaning experience compared to portable vacuums.
- Impact on Comfort: A quieter system means you can vacuum without disturbing sleeping children, work-from-home spouses, or even having a conversation in an adjacent room.
- What to Look For: Many manufacturers include integrated mufflers, noise-blocking foam, or soft-start technologies to further reduce operational sound. Some top-tier systems operate as low as 58dB, making them practically whisper-quiet indoors. If the power unit will be installed near living areas, prioritize models with excellent noise reduction features.
Canister Capacity
The capacity of the dirt collection canister determines how frequently you will need to empty it. Central vacuum canisters typically range from 4 to over 9 gallons, or 16 to 41 liters.
- Impact on Convenience: A larger capacity means less frequent emptying, which is particularly beneficial for larger homes, households with pets, or those with heavy cleaning needs. For an average family of four, a 6-gallon (25L) canister might need emptying every 5-7 weeks, while a smaller 4-gallon unit could require it every 1-2 weeks.
- Matching to Home Size: For a new home, consider the total square footage and anticipated dirt load. A larger home or one with multiple pets will benefit significantly from a higher capacity unit to minimize maintenance tasks.
Filtration System
The filtration system is critical for indoor air quality, especially for residents with allergies or asthma. Central vacuum systems generally offer superior filtration compared to portable vacuums, as the exhaust is typically vented outside or through a highly efficient filter system.
- Types of Filters:
- HEPA Filters: High-Efficiency Particulate Air filters are a gold standard, capable of capturing 99.97% of airborne particles as small as 0.3 microns, including dust mites, pet dander, pollen, and mold spores.
- Micron Pre-filters: These coarse filters catch larger particles before they reach finer filters or the motor, extending the life of other filter components.
- Cyclonic Separation: Many bagless systems use centrifugal force to separate dirt and debris into the canister, often followed by a fine filter.
- Importance: For new home builds, integrating a system with excellent filtration, ideally HEPA or a multi-stage hybrid system, can significantly reduce indoor allergens and contribute to a healthier living environment.

Other Features
Beyond the core specifications, several other features can enhance the convenience and longevity of your central vacuum system.
- Soft-Start Technology: This feature gradually ramps up the motor speed, reducing stress on the motor and potentially extending its lifespan by up to 20%.
- Accessory Kits: Comprehensive kits often include specialized tools like powered vacuum heads for carpets, crevice tools for tight spaces, dusting brushes, upholstery tools, and floor brushes for hard surfaces. Some even include garage-specific attachments.
- LED Indicators: Useful lights can alert you when the canister is full or if there’s a system blockage, simplifying maintenance.
- Inlet Types: Consider different inlet designs, such as standard wall inlets, automatic dustpans (kick plates) for kitchens, and retractable hose systems that store the hose inside the wall.
- Hose Length and Material: Hoses typically come in lengths from 30 to 50 feet. Longer hoses reduce the number of inlets required, but can be heavier. Consider lightweight, crush-proof hoses for durability and ease of use.
Central Vacuum System Buying Guide for New Home Builds
Installing a central vacuum system during a new home build is the ideal scenario, allowing for seamless integration of tubing and inlets. Here’s a structured approach to ensure you choose the perfect system for your new residence.
-
Define Your Needs and Home Specifications:
- Home Size: Accurately measure your home’s square footage. Central vacuum systems are rated for specific coverage areas. Aim for a system rated 20-25% higher than your actual square footage to ensure optimal performance.
- Floor Types: Do you have mostly carpets, hardwood, tile, or a mix? Different power units and accessory kits are optimized for various surfaces. A powered brush head is essential for carpets, while a horsehair brush is gentle on hard floors.
- Household Composition: Do you have pets? Allergy sufferers? These factors heavily influence the required suction power, filtration type (HEPA or bagged systems are better for allergies), and canister capacity.
- Cleaning Frequency: How often do you plan to vacuum? More frequent cleaning might warrant a larger canister or a system designed for heavy-duty use.
-
Establish Your Budget:
- Central vacuum systems involve two main costs: the unit itself and installation. Power units can range from a few hundred to over a thousand dollars.
- Installation Costs: Professional installation for a new home typically ranges from $1,200 to $3,400, depending on the home’s size and complexity. While DIY is possible, it requires specialized tools and knowledge of home construction, and mistakes can be costly to fix. Factor in these costs early in your build planning.
-
Research Brands and Models:
- Leverage online reviews, comparison sites, and manufacturer websites. Pay attention to airwatt ratings, canister capacity, filtration types, noise levels, and included accessories.
- Look for brands with a strong reputation for durability and customer service.
-
Evaluate Installation Options:
- Since it’s a new build, work closely with your builder and potentially an experienced central vacuum installer. They can plan optimal tubing routes, power unit placement (garage or basement is ideal for noise reduction), and inlet locations (typically one inlet per 700 square feet).
- Discuss specialized inlets like kitchen automatic dustpans or Vroom systems for garages and utility rooms for added convenience.
-
Consider Warranty and Long-Term Costs:
- Warranties for central vacuum power units typically range from 5 to 10 years, with some offering lifetime coverage on certain components. A longer warranty often signifies confidence in the product’s durability.
- Factor in potential long-term costs: replacement bags (if applicable, $60-120/year), filter replacements ($20-50 every 1-2 years), and occasional professional maintenance ($100-200 every 2-3 years).
Reputable Central Vacuum System Brands
The central vacuum market features several manufacturers known for quality, innovation, and reliability. When considering a system for your new home, these brands are often highly rated:
- OVO: Frequently appears in top recommendations, offering a range of powerful hybrid systems with strong airwatt ratings (e.g., OVO 750AW, OVO 700AW). Known for soft-start technology and quiet operation.
- Prolux: Offers robust, often bagless, systems with high power, suitable for very large homes (e.g., Prolux CV12000).
- Ultra Clean: Provides good value systems, often hybrid, with integrated mufflers for reduced noise (e.g., Ultra Clean SC200).
- Cana-vac: A Canadian-made brand known for durable systems with powerful motors and excellent filtration, including HEPA options.
- Nutone: A well-established brand offering a variety of central vacuum units with different power levels and capacities.
- Beam: Another long-standing brand in the central vacuum industry, known for reliable and powerful systems.
- VacuMaid: Offers a range of cyclonic and inverted bag systems, focusing on strong performance and effective dirt separation.
- Riccar: Known for quality home cleaning appliances, their central vacuum systems typically offer hybrid filtration and robust construction.
- HP Dirt Devil: Provides more compact and affordable options, often suitable for smaller homes or specific utility areas.
- Drainvac: Offers premium Canadian-made systems, often with very large capacities and high airwatt ratings.

Frequently Asked Questions
How much does central vacuum installation cost in a new home?
Professional central vacuum installation in a new home typically ranges from $1,200 to $3,400. This cost varies based on your home’s size, the number of inlets, and the complexity of the tubing runs, ensuring a custom fit for your specific blueprint.
Are central vacuum systems worth the investment for a new build?
Yes, central vacuum systems are a worthwhile investment, especially for new home builds, as they offer superior cleaning power, improve indoor air quality by removing allergens, and significantly increase convenience by eliminating heavy portable vacuums. They can also enhance your home’s resale value.
Can I install a central vacuum system myself during construction?
While DIY installation is technically possible, it is highly recommended to use a professional installer during new home construction. Proper pipe routing, sealing, and power unit placement are crucial for system efficiency and avoiding costly mistakes that could impact performance.
How long do central vacuum systems typically last?
Central vacuum systems are renowned for their durability, often lasting 7-10 years with proper maintenance, though some units can exceed 20 years. Features like “soft-start” technology can further extend the motor’s lifespan, protecting your investment.
What size central vacuum system do I need for my new house?
The appropriate size depends on your home’s square footage; aim for a unit rated for 20-25% more square footage than your actual home size to ensure consistent suction at all inlets. For example, a 3,000 sq ft home might benefit from a system rated for 3,600-3,750 sq ft or more.
